The 2000 Liberia 20 Dollars Amsterdam silver coin is an impressive architectural commemorative from the European Landmarks series, celebrating the unmistakable urban character of Amsterdam, Netherlands. Struck in .999 fine silver and certified PCGS PR69, it combines an exceptionally high Proof grade with a richly detailed cityscape. The Amsterdam side presents traditional narrow canal houses with varied façades, windows and rooftops, a stone arched canal bridge with railings, leafy trees, an imposing domed classical building, additional historic architecture, and two highly detailed bicycles in the foreground. These elements capture Amsterdam’s famous relationship with canals, historic buildings and cycling culture. The opposite side features Liberia’s national coat of arms: a sailing ship approaching the coast, palm tree, rising sun, plow and landscape, surrounded by ornamental ribbons and the 2000 date. Amsterdam’s canal districts and distinctive architecture make the city one of Europe’s most recognizable historic urban landscapes.
